Peter Dupas faces court charged with murder of Kathleen Downes

MELBOURNE man Peter Dupas will face trial next year charged with the 1997 murder of Kathleen Downes. He appeared in court via videolink today for a brief hearing.

MELBOURNE man Peter Dupas has appeared in the Supreme Court via video link charged with the murder of Kathleen Downes.

Mrs Downes, 95, was murdered in a Brunswick nursing home in 1997.

The alleged killer was interviewed over the murder in 2001, but refused to comment.

Mrs Downes was a resident at the Brunswick Lodge nursing home when an intruder stabbed her to death at 6.30am on December 31, 1997.

A homicide investigation revealed Mr Dupas had telephoned the nursing home and asked for Mrs Downes sometime before her murder.

The murder trial has been scheduled for January next year.
